Insurance commissioner launches redesigned website

The state agency that regulates the insurance industry has launched a revamped, mobile-friendly website designed to be much easier to use for both consumers and industry professionals.

 

The website redesign is part of an ongoing effort to work online with consumers, agents, brokers and companies. Agent and broker licensing is now done almost entirely online. Consumers can file complaints online, email questions and check the status of their cases 24/7, the agency said.

“When people have insurance problems, they want information fast,” said Insurance Commissioner Mike Kreidler. “They have limited time, and they may be on a smartphone or other device. We want to make it easy for them.”
